Эффективные расширения для вики-разработки

Наша небольшая команда из 3-4 разработчиков использует вики для документации и совместной работы. Я пытаюсь составить список некоторых надежных расширений, которые помогут сделать его лучше. Мы используем MediaWiki, но если вы знаете хорошее расширение / плагин для другой платформы, я бы тоже хотел об этом услышать. Спасибо.

Вот мой список на данный момент:

  • Geshi для выделения синтаксиса.
  • FCKeditor
  • TagAsCategory

Перспективные расширения, которые не работают с MediaWiki 1.15.0

  • CategoryEditor
  • IssueTracker

person Rob    schedule 17.06.2009    source источник
comment
Я нашел довольно скрытую ссылку на mediwiki.org - mediawiki.org/wiki/Category:Must -have_extensions также mediawiki.org/wiki/Category:Corporate_Must-have_extensions Кажется, там есть и более многообещающие расширения.   -  person Rob    schedule 27.06.2009


Ответы (2)


На ум приходят две вещи:

  • Интеграция с инструментом отслеживания ошибок
  • Интеграция инструментов SCM

Для MediaWiki уже есть

Интеграция с Bugzilla:

Интеграция SVN:

Полный список расширений находится здесь

person Vinko Vrsalovic    schedule 17.06.2009
comment
Спасибо, я уже видел этот список раньше, но в нем слишком много вещей, чтобы разобраться в нем. Кроме того, похоже, что всякий раз, когда я нахожу что-то, что может быть полезно, оно сломано :( - person Rob; 21.06.2009

Что ж, я думаю, что хорошей отправной точкой было бы проверить, что мы используем, на mediawiki.org, потому что это разработка Вики :)

Моим первым выбором, конечно же, был бы CodeReview. Это некрасиво, но очень полезно. См. как мы его используем: он позволяет интегрировать SVN в вики, добавлять комментарии к коду, отмечать коммиты и ставить ему статусы. В MediaWiki мы используем цепочку new / Verified / ok, добавляя fixme / reverted / resolved / deferred, когда что-то пойдет не так; но здесь вы можете использовать свои собственные статусы.

person Nicolas Dumazet    schedule 17.06.2009
comment
Мы используем VSTS для управления версиями. - person Rob; 21.06.2009